Saudi Arabia 2 Riyals - King Salman (2016) Coin
© Chiefa Coins
Features
-
Issuer: Saudi Arabia
-
King: Salman bin Abdulaziz (2015–present)
-
Type: Standard Circulation Coin
-
Year: 1438 AH (2016)
-
Calendar: Islamic (Hijri)
-
Value: 2 Riyals (2 SAR = ~INR 46)
-
Currency: Riyal (1960–present)
-
Composition: Bimetallic (Brass-plated steel center with a copper-nickel ring)
-
Weight: 6.7 g
-
Diameter: 25.0 mm
-
Thickness: 1.8 mm
-
Shape: Round
-
Technique: Milled
-
Orientation: Medal Alignment (↑↑)
Obverse Design
- Portrait of King 'Abd al-'Aziz bin 'Abd ar-Rahman Al Sa'ud, the founder of the Al Sa'ud dynasty.
- The design features multiple Coats of Arms intricately set within floral ornamentation.
-
Script: Arabic
-
Inscription: الملك عبد العزيز بن عبد الرحمن آل سعود
-
Translation: King 'Abd al-'Aziz bin 'Abd ar-Rahman Al Sa'ud
Reverse Design
- Multiple Coats of Arms within detailed floral ornamentation.
-
Script: Arabic
-
Inscription: 1438
